Safety Precautions

This pump is 

ONLY 

for use with the following:

Clean water or water with small solids in suspension (dirty water).

Diesel fuel

Paraffin

DO NOT

 use this pump for pumping:

Slurry

Septic tanks

Sandy water

WARNING: DO NOT USE FOR PUMPING PETROL

ALWAYS

 disconnect the pump from the power supply before performing any

maintenance.

ALWAYS

 check the power cable before use to ensure it is perfectly serviceable.

ALWAYS 

ensure the filter is clean and perfectly serviceable before use.

NEVER 

run the pump dry. 

Minimum water depth is 30mm.

DO NOT

 exceed the duty cycle - see Specifications.

DO NOT

 use if any part appears to be damaged. Have it repaired by your Clarke dealer.

DO NOT

 use the pump for any purpose other than that for which it is intended.

DO NOT

 operate the pump continuously - eg. in a fish pond or collection tank, water

feature etc.

DO NOT

 use or leave the pump in freezing conditions.

DO NOT

 allow uncontrolled discharge of 

contaminated water etc. ALWAYS collect in

a container and dispose of according to all H & S and local regulations.

Specifications

Flow Rate ..................................................... 16.5 litres/min

Min. Water Depth ....................................... 30mm

Voltage ........................................................ 12V

Current ......................................................... 4.5A DC

Pressure ........................................................ 15psi / 1 bar

Height ........................................................... 145mm

Diameter ...................................................... 53.5mm

Weight .......................................................... 0.6kg

Duty cycle ................................................... 15mins continuous in any

30 min period

Method of Operation

1.

Always check to ensure the pump is in perfect working order:

- has no apparent damage

- the filter is in place and is perfectly clean

- the power cable is in perfect condition

2.

Attach the flexible hose to the outlet, securing with the jubilee clip supplied.

3.

If required, attach the stainless steel tube to the discharge end of the flexible hose,
securing with the jubilee clip supplied.

4.

Carefully lower the pump into the pit or sump etc, to be drained.

IMPORTANT; if the bottom of the pit or sump is muddy or sandy, position the pump on a brick
or similar support. DO NOT allow it to rest in the mud or sand.

5.

Connect the clamps to the 12Volt battery and the pump will operate.

IMPORTANT: ALWAYS connect the red - positive clamp to the red positive terminal of the
battery FIRST, then connect the black clamp to the black - negative terminal, ensuring both
clamps are perfectly secure.

When disconnecting - ALWAYS disconnect the black - negative clamp FIRST.

Always observe the pump discharging. Should performance deteriorate during use, it is
probable that the filter is becoming blocked. In this case, disconnect the pump from the
battery - (black terminal first), then carefully remove the pump from the pit or sump etc. 

DO

NOT yank the cable.

Unscrew the base cap and remove the filter. Either clean thoroughly or replace as necessary,
then check the impeller to ensure it is free to rotate and is not blocked.

When satisfied, replace pump in sump or pit and resume pumping.

When finished ALWAYS remove the filter and clean thoroughly, then allow it to dry.

Thoroughly clean the pump with clean water and ensure the impeller is completely free to
rotate and is free of contaminants.

Reassemble the pump and store in a clean dry environment.
